

SHREVEPORT, LA – Celebrating the life of Charles H. (Sonny) Andrews II who was born February 7, 1929, in San Antonio, TX, to Charles H. Andrews and Lillian Glass Andrews Sweeny. Sonny died November 25, 2014, after losing his battle with cancer at Grace Home in Shreveport. Sonny attended Jefferson Military Academy and after graduation joined the US Navy where he served as a Fire Controlman from 1948 to 1952 on the Destroyer USS Agerholm (826) during the Korean War and also played on the Navy Championship Softball team. Sonny married his wife, Bobbie Jean Stevens Andrews, on February 17, 1956. He donated most of his time working as an Auxiliary Police Officer with the Shreveport Police Department and also as a Caddo Parish Reserve Deputy until going to work as a University Police Officer with LSUS Medical Center where he retired as a Sergeant. After retiring Sonny enjoyed wood working, spending time with his great-grandchildren, and was an avid LSU fan until his illness prevented him from continuing with his passions.
Sonny was preceded in death by his mother, father, and most of his friends. He is survived in death by his wife Bobbie of 58 years; his daughter, Becky Harbour and husband Danny of Emmet, AR; his son, Chuck Andrews and wife Leslie of Haughton, LA; three grandchildren, Crystal Andrews McKenna and husband Steve, Megan Andrews, and Cody Andrews; five great-grandchildren, Devin McKenna, Drew McKenna, Cameron Andrews, Grayson Billedeaux, and Kristie Andrews; along with two step great-grandchildren, Jaycelyn Billedeaux and Alayna Perdue.
